Transaction 901dbbaf619bf53bbaf79bb4048eee0801721d302812169f8b19cb5fb724b7e6
1 Input
1 Output
-
901dbbaf619bf53bbaf79bb4048eee0801721d302812169f8b19cb5fb724b7e6:0
- value
- 3660978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3d3b17004d857ae5a19e4ee13d7b84fd535c105 OP_EQUAL
- address
- 3KYTHeS7ZGQXF8iRBXnV9uJ19WJGpCuydn